Drama Day 2008 challenged the four houses to create a 15 minute play in a morning, complete with set, costumes, props, lighting and music on the theme of ‘Reflections’. The V Form House Prefects were magnificent! They had each planned carefully the style, plot, and ‘look’ of the performance. Each member of the House was busily involved in the creation and the performances in the afternoon. All had large casts of actors, dancers, singers and instrumentalists. It was really splendid to see the I Form working alongside the V Form in a genuinely happy and creative atmosphere. Congratulations to all who took part and thank you for giving the school such varied and accomplished performances. Incidentally, St. John’s House were the winners this year!

With the weather looking grim and the prospect of getting very muddy looming, Year 4 embarked on a trip that, for some, would be their first time away from home. Excitement coupled with anticipation and nervousness was high. Since the middle of September Mrs Whicher and Mr Walker had been preparing Year 4 for this trip, explaining what would happen and what to expect and now the time had arrived.

Year 4 were accompanied by Mrs Bothwell and Miss Orbell as well as their intrepid class teachers! We were all impressed by the way in which year 4 threw themselves into it and tried their best in every activity.

Upon arrival at Bethany house we were greeted by Sophie, the manager and Myles, our group leader. Both of them were in charge of organising us, making sure we ate on time and got to the correct activity on schedule. After finding our rooms (and engaging in the annual problem of putting a sheet on a duvet, for some children!) the children were taken for the first of their 3 evening activities lead by Myles. Afterwards we began the task which haunts the dreams of every teacher on residential, bedtime!
